On Sunday, Chinese Premier Li Qiang met with Italian Prime Minister Giorgia Meloni in Beijing, and they signed a bunch of new cooperation agreements. We're talking industry, education, environmental protection, and even food safety! Yum! 🍝🍜
This year marks the 20th anniversary of the China-Italy comprehensive strategic partnership. 🥳 Premier Li is all about strengthening this long-standing bond and wants to bring more benefits to the people of both countries. They're not stopping at government talks. Li is encouraging deeper collaborations in shipbuilding, aerospace, new energy, and artificial intelligence! 🚀⚡🤖 And here's a fun twist: with the 700th anniversary of Marco Polo's death coming up, they're planning cultural exchanges in art, film, and education. Li also gave a shoutout to Chinese companies looking to invest in Italy and hopes for a fair and welcoming environment. Plus, he believes that openness and cooperation are the keys to winning big in this global game. He called on the EU to keep an open mind about China's growth so they can tackle global challenges together. 🌐✌️
Prime Minister Meloni is totally on board! She wants to deepen practical cooperation in economy, trade, investment, science, and culture. She's all about building that bridge of friendship and exploring new opportunities. 🚢🔬 She also emphasized Italy's readiness to promote open dialogue between the EU and China for a more stable and cooperative relationship.
